Mike Nugent played for the Jets from 2005 to 2008, the Buccaneers in 2009, the Cardinals in 2009, the Bengals from 2010 to 2016, the Bears in 2017, the Cowboys in 2017, the Raiders in 2018, the Patriots in 2019 and the Cardinals in 2020.

what teams do mike nugent play for

See Trending NFL Searches